The City of Tustin in California is soliciting bids for the Main Street Well 3 and Newport Well 3 Improvements Project scheduled for 2026 and 2027. This project falls under NAICS code 237110 for dredging and dredging-related activities and will be performed within Tustin, California. Interested parties must submit their responses by the deadline of September 15, 2026. Primary points of contact for this solicitation are Kenny Nguyen and Hy Dang-Libunao. Detailed information and submission guidelines can be accessed through the BidAmerica portal using solicitation number 20260811029.

Hagerstown Wastewater Treatment Plant Improvements - Phase 1
Solicitation # hagerstown-wastewater-treatment-plant-improvements-phase-1
The Hagerstown Wastewater Treatment Plant Improvements - Phase 1 project, managed by Carl Belt, Inc., focuses on upgrading aging infrastructure in Maryland to ensure compliance with nitrogen, phosphorous, and NPDES thermal permit limits. The scope of work aims to enhance plant reliability and the water quality of receiving streams without increasing overall treatment capacity. Key technical deliverables include the replacement of influent screens, washer compactors, in-plant and RAS pumps, and the operations building sanitary grinder pump station. Additionally, the project involves installing a headworks enclosure building, a dedicated chemical storage building for ferric chloride/alum, new nitrate probes for BNR basins, and the replacement of motor control centers, PLCs, and switchgear. Structural repairs to the headworks concrete and various building improvements to HVAC, roofing, and entryways are also required. This is a wage-rated solicitation with a response deadline of August 17, 2026, at 4:00 PM. The project strongly encourages participation from small businesses, including SDB, WOSB, HUBZone, and veteran-owned concerns, and specifically seeks MBE, DBE, and WBE participants for various electrical, mechanical, and masonry subcontracts, as well as specialized supplies like wastewater pumps and sluice gates. Bids and detailed plans are managed through the Carl Belt, Inc. portal. Primary administrative contact for the project is Jared Burkett, and the primary point of contact for the solicitation is Jennifer Wilson.

Cypress Lake WTP, Wellfield, & Raw Water Main in Osceola County, FL
Solicitation # cypress-lake-wtp-wellfield-raw-water-main-osceola-county-fl
Wharton-Smith, Inc. is soliciting proposals from State of Florida Certified Disadvantaged Business Enterprise (DBE) subcontractors and suppliers for the Cypress Lake WTP, Wellfield, and Raw Water Main project in Osceola County, Florida. This project, owned by the Central Florida Water Cooperative, has an estimated value of 270 million dollars. The scope of work is extensive, encompassing the construction of raw water production wells, well heads, pumps, discharge piping, and a surge bladder tank. Additional requirements include site civil work, a wellhead cage, an electrical building, a standby generator, and the construction of several specialized facilities, including Operations and Reverse Osmosis buildings, pretreatment and post-treatment chemical buildings, a post-treatment degasification system, and an odor control air exhaust dispersion stack system. The project also requires primary and secondary water quality analytical laboratory testing and production well disinfection to achieve regulatory certification. Interested parties must adhere to a strict submission timeline, with the proposed scope of work due at least 24 hours before the bid date and firm pricing required by 10:00 AM on the day of the bid. The final bid deadline is August 19, 2026, at 2:00 PM EST. Proposals should be emailed to Nichole Voitel at watergmpbids@whartonsmith.com. Bidding documents, including plans, specifications, and addenda, are available for free download via ConstructConnect. Wharton-Smith, Inc. has indicated a willingness to review responsible quotes and negotiate terms where appropriate.

Central Coast Blue AWPF
Solicitation # central-coast-blue-awpf
Filanc is soliciting quotes for the Central Coast Blue Advanced Water Purification Facility (AWPF) project located at 966 Huber St., Pismo Beach, California. The project involves the construction of a new facility with a nominal product water capacity of approximately 0.50mgd to produce 500AFY. The scope of work is extensive, encompassing a 200,000-gallon equalization storage tank, advanced treatment systems including pressurized MF/UF, a two-stage RO system, and a UV/AOP system, as well as post-treatment facilities for stabilization and chlorination. Infrastructure requirements include chemical storage and feed systems, a purified water storage tank and pump station, approximately 2,000 linear feet of HDPE pipeline for influent and RO concentrate, and groundwater recharge infrastructure consisting of one injection well and two monitoring wells. The solicitation is open to a wide range of trades, including demolition, structural steel, HVAC, plumbing, and specialized process equipment. Bids are due by 2:00 PM on August 13, 2026. The project adheres to Build America, Buy America (BABA) requirements and strongly encourages participation from small, minority-owned, women-owned, and veteran-owned businesses. Filanc has committed to providing assistance with bonding, credit lines, and insurance for qualified SBE, MBE, and WBE participants to ensure equal opportunity. Plans and specifications are available at no cost through the primary point of contact, Julia Masaitis.

SEWER CONSTRUCTION
Solicitation # Sanitary Contract No. 866
Sanitary Contract No. 866, issued by the City of Baltimore Department of Public Works Office of Engineering and Construction, involves the Replacement of the Southwest Diversion Pressure Sewer - Phase I Frankfurt Avenue in Maryland. The primary scope of work includes the open-cut construction and installation of approximately 4,450 linear feet of 102-inch sewer pipe, along with associated appurtenances and surface repair. This project is supported by the U.S. EPA Water Infrastructure Finance and Innovation Act (WIFIA) and the Maryland Water Quality and Drinking Water Revolving Loan Fund, with established socioeconomic goals of 22 percent for Minority Business Enterprises (MBE) and 16 percent for Women Business Enterprises (WBE). To be eligible for award, contractors must be prequalified by the City of Baltimore Department of Public Works Office of Boards and Commissions in category B02552 - Sewer Construction, with a required cost qualification range between 60,000,000.01 and 70,000,000.00 dollars. Sealed bids must be submitted in duplicate to the Board of Estimates of the Mayor and City Council of Baltimore at the Office of the Comptroller by 11:00 A.M. on August 5, 2026. Joint ventures are permitted provided that the establishing documentation is submitted with the bid. Administrative inquiries are managed by Lotania Walston and Darryn Mobley, with a final question deadline of July 8, 2026.

Armstrong Avenue Pedestrian Bridge (Cip No.70257) & Neighborhood D South Phase 2 Package #2 Improvements (Cip No.70256)
Solicitation # 20260724017
The project encompasses comprehensive infrastructure improvements in the Neighborhood D South and Linear Park areas of Tustin, California, centered on the construction of a pedestrian bridge spanning Armstrong Avenue. Scope includes fine grading, ARHM roadway overlay, removals and adjustments, installation of dry utilities coordinated with multiple agencies including Southern California Edison, AT&T, Cox Communications, and Southern California Gas Company, as well as hardscape, landscaping, irrigation, pavement striping, signing and delineation, traffic signal installation and interconnection, street and pathway lighting. All work must adhere to City of Tustin Improvement Standards 108, 109, and 110, the California Building Code 2022, and industry standards such as ASTM C150, C-33, C-94, ACI 318/315, and ASTM A515 Grade 60 for reinforcing steel. Excavation and trenching activities require coordination with Underground Service Alert and full compliance with utility agency specifications, with inspections and acceptance occurring on-site. The solicitation, issued under number 20260724017, is open for responses until August 25, 2026, with performance limited to the specified locations in Tustin.
